Job description

Required September 2026 Term time including INSET days8.15am to 3pm including unpaid lunch time of 30 minutesRate of pay - NJC Scale 3, SCP point range 5-6 = FTE £25,583 - £25,989 depending on experienceActual Salary £19,367 - £19,661 inclusive of London Fringe Allowance

Herschel Grammar School is a mixed, selective school graded ‘outstanding’ by Ofsted.

The post holder will deliver pre-set work to classes in the absence of teachers plus other pupil and administrative related duties.

The appointment will be subject to a clear DBS search and we aim to appoint individuals who:

  • have good practical skills and attention to detail
  • are approachable, caring but firm
  • are able to work with teachers and students in a calm manner
  • have good standards of literacy and numeracy and ICT skills
  • are energetic, creative and hands-on in all they do
  • can work collaboratively in a team
  • can recognise the success in students, others and themselves, as the first building block to improvement
  • are extremely flexible and can cope with change
  • have an openness to training and personal development

We offer a competitive salary, a friendly and supportive working environment, health and medical benefits and the option to join the Local Government Pension Scheme, in which the employee pays 5.5% and the employer contributes a further 20.6%.
